Motifは時代遅れか?

1Motifプログラマ
垢版 |
NGNG
俺は、Linux上でLessTif使ってGUIアプリ書いてる。
みなさんは、C/C++でGUIアプリを作るときは何をつかってますか?
GTK+, Qt, V, wxWindows ....
商用UNIXへの移植を考えるとMotifが無難と思うが。。。
NGNG
持っていくだけならftpでもnfsでもどうぞ。
40名無しさん@お腹いっぱい。
垢版 |
NGNG
>>37
どんな点が悪影響?
NGNG
>40
それを書くほどのスキルがないから匿名でボヤくんだよ。
42名無しさん@お腹いっぱい。
垢版 |
NGNG
>>38
MotifならWinでもCygwin+XFree86+lesstif環境を構築すれば
基本的にはそのままでOK。
NGNG
>>42
それは、「MotifのアプリをWindowsに持っていく」といえるのか?
44名無しさん@お腹いっぱい。
垢版 |
NGNG
そういえば、要XサーバなWindowsアプリがあったな。
45名無しさん@お腹いっぱい。
垢版 |
NGNG
>>43
激しく同意。
その方法だとソースがあるツールキット全部がOKじゃんか。
46名無しさん@お腹いっぱい。
垢版 |
NGNG
>>38
Qtはまさに「そのまま」持っていける。
たしかMacOSにも持っていけたと思う。
47名無しさん@お腹いっぱい。
垢版 |
NGNG
wxWindows

とか言ってみるテスト。
48名無しさん@お腹いっぱい。
垢版 |
NGNG
>>45
基本的に同意なんだけどバイナリがあるのとないのでは
ちょっとは違いがあるかもとかいってみるテスト

NGNG
>>48
それ言い始めたらVMWareとかも‥(ふがふぐ)。
50名無しさん@お腹いっぱい。
垢版 |
NGNG
むずかすぃ。今仕事で使用中。俺はCもままならんっちゅうねん。
51sage
垢版 |
NGNG
Motifだめ。全然だめ。
でもお仕事でたまーーーに使います。
(枯れてるからねぇ)
52名無しさん@お腹いっぱい。
垢版 |
NGNG
>>51
確かに良さは枯れてることだけだよね。
OpenMotifが出てなかったらもう終わってる頃だったのに。
53名無しさん@お腹いっぱい。
垢版 |
NGNG
>>38
> Motifで組んだアプリってWindowsにそのまま持って行けるの?

Windows用Motif見た事あるよ。6,7年前にデータショウで。
NT3.5.1/Win3.1用だったと思う(w
54名無しさん@お腹いっぱい。
垢版 |
NGNG
OpenMotif-2.2 age
55名無しさん@お腹いっぱい。
垢版 |
NGNG
>>44
gambit
56名無しさん@お腹いっぱい。
垢版 |
NGNG
uilって使えるの?
NGNG
>>56
使えます。コンパイルして UID 作ったら
プログラムから MrmOpenHirarchy() & MrmFetchWidget()。
…ちょっと辛いかも。
58名無しさん@お腹いっぱい。
垢版 |
NGNG
Motifあげ
59名無しさん@お腹いっぱい。
垢版 |
NGNG
Solaris8(x86)で、/usr/dt/examples/motifにあった
サンプルをMakeしてみたが、まともに動作しないものが
いくつか見受けられた。

というわけで、「Motifは時代遅れ」どころか、
「既にまともにサポートされていない」に1票。
60名無しさん@お腹いっぱい。
垢版 |
NGNG
Motifっていっても、単なるウィジェットセットでしょ?
Xt使うこと自体は別に悪くはないような気もする。

Gtk+も使ってみたけど、Cで無理矢理オブジェクト指向やってるから
最初かなりとっつきにくかった。
NGNG
Xtは、リソースがうざい。
Xtベースじゃない、Motifライクなツールキット/ウィジェットを
希望したいところ。
NGNG
>>59
OpenLookを捨ててMotifに移行するって発表したときにあれだけ大騒動
になったのに、消えるときはなんかあっさりしているなぁ。
NGNG
OpenLookを捨てたあとも、XViewは長く尾を引いているな。
見た目にはOpenLookとXViewは区別が付かないけど…
NGNG
>59
Intel版だからじゃないの?
NGNG
>>64
Intel版であることが影響するの?
NGNG
motifマンセー
67名無しさん@お腹いっぱい。
垢版 |
NGNG
MWM MWM MWM MWM MWM MWM MWM MWM MWM MWM
WM MWM MWM MWM MWM MWM MWM MWM MWM MWM M
M MWM MWM MWM MWM MWM MWM MWM MWM MWM MW
MWM MWM MWM MWM MWM MWM MWM MWM MWM MWM
MWM MWM MWM MWM MWM MWM MWM MWM MWM MWM
WM MWM MWM MWM MWM MWM MWM MWM MWM MWM M
M MWM MWM MWM MWM MWM MWM MWM MWM MWM MW
MWM MWM MWM MWM MWM MWM MWM MWM MWM MWM
MWM MWM MWM MWM MWM MWM MWM MWM MWM MWM
WM MWM MWM MWM MWM MWM MWM MWM MWM MWM M
M MWM MWM MWM MWM MWM MWM MWM MWM MWM MW
MWM MWM MWM MWM MWM MWM MWM MWM MWM MWM

NGNG
OpenMotifのmwmってvirtual desktop使えないのがカナスィ。
NGNG
>>68
え、そうなの。
lesstif のは使えたと思ったけどな。
OpenMotif は make 方式が古くていや。
NGNG
>>69
Lesstiffのmwmはfvwmの改造版だからな

OpenMotifいまのバージョンはGNU Configureでさっくりmakeできるけど
71名無しさん
垢版 |
NGNG
GUIってさぁ、画面つくるだけでしょ。帳票作っているのと同じ。
プログラム作っているって感じがしない。その上、使い勝手が悪い
とか見栄えが良くないって、トーしろのオッサンから文句言われる
し。疲れるだけ。
NGNG
( ´_ゝ`)フーン
NGNG
Motifの画面デザインは結構好きだけどなー。
XMosaicとか好きだった。
GTkは新しいのかも知れないが何かセンスが感じられなくて..。
NGNG
>>73
Gtk+は画面デザインほぼまるまる総とっ替えできるわけだが
NGNG
>>74
そうなんだけど、何か微妙なところで偽物感が漂うんだよね。
NEXTSTEPを模倣したwmとか libneXtaw なんかもそうなんだけど。
細かい所できちんとしたデザイナの介入があるかどうかで, 意外と
違ってくると思われ。(いい例はSGIだと思う)
76名無しさん@お腹いっぱい。
垢版 |
NGNG
age
NGNG
gtk+はSolarisのhtt + Atokと相性が悪いから嫌い

;; まあAtokが腐っていると言う説も・・・
NGNG
おーっ、Motif擦れがあがってる♪
gtk+はウィジェットリソース固まってない時点で逝ね!

79名無しさん@お腹いっぱい。
垢版 |
NGNG
openmotif-2.2.2.tgz の CKSUMS ファイルに書かれている
POSIX cksum や SysV sum って間違ってませんか?

俺のところでは
$ cksum openmotif-2.2.2.tgz
3466589788 5192862 openmotif-2.2.2.tgz
$ sum -s openmotif-2.2.2.tgz
62717 10143 openmotif-2.2.2.tgz

になって、CKSUMS の記述と違うんだけど、
これでいいのかな。
NGNG
あぼーん
81名無しさん@お腹いっぱい。
垢版 |
NGNG
KDEではQtを使っているらしいけど、Qtで作ったものはfvwmとかtwmで動く?
NGNG
>>81

Qtライブラリがあるか、
スタティックリンクされていれば動く。
83名無しさん@お腹いっぱい。
垢版 |
NGNG
>>81

ありがとう。 でも、スタティックリンクっていうのが分からないんですが、これは何?
NGNG
>>81-83
すれ違い。
全然 Motif に関係ない話すな。
NGNG
でも、関係ない話でもない限り、Motif ネタなんて全然出てこないのよねぇ... *SIGH*
86山崎渉
垢版 |
NGNG
(^^)
87名無しさん@お腹いっぱい。
垢版 |
NGNG
やっぱりmotifは時代遅れかな
88名無しさん@お腹いっぱい。
垢版 |
NGNG
モチーーーーーーーーーーフ!
NGNG
餅麩
90名無しさん@お腹いっぱい。
垢版 |
NGNG
GTKでつくったアプリは見栄えがよくないね。
商用UNIXのCDE/Motifでつくったアプリはゴージャス!




91名無しさん@お腹いっぱい。
垢版 |
NGNG
やっぱりmotifは時代遅れかな
NGNG
GTKのUIってWindowsともまた違った安っぽさがあるよな
93名無しさん@お腹いっぱい。
垢版 |
NGNG
Motifはゴージャス!
NGNG
一瞬、DTM板と間違ったかな、と思ってしまった。
どうでもいいのでsage
NGNG
やっぱりmotifは時代遅れかな
NGNG
>>4が1年3ヶ月前に、
>Gtk とか Qt とかって1年後には Qt-3.0 ですよとか Gtk-2.0 ですとか出てきて
>すぐに今のが陳腐化しそうな切迫感があって恐いです。
と言っているが、Gtk+は2.0が出ているにもかかわらず、いまだに1.2.xの方が主流で使われているような気がする。
Gtk+1.2は、慣れるまでちょっと大変だけど、慣れるとかなり使いやすい。
NGNG
アプリ作者が、1.2の知識は十分にあるけど、
1.2で十分なのに、2を覚えるのが面倒だからとか。

今あるツールが1.2ベースだから、これから覚えようとしてる人も、
1.2の方を勉強しちゃうとか。
NGNG
1.2 って「やっと枯れて来た」って感じじゃない?
NGNG
そうだね。
枯れてきたころが、widgetの花。
NGNG
言えてる。
正直今のGtk+ 1.2系を残せる環境が欲しい。
2.0に移行じゃなくて並列みたいな感じで。

スレ違いsage。
NGNG
>>96
純粋に Window だ Button を出したいだけならどっちもさほど変わらんけど、
Pango の導入で hoge_font() 系関数と hoge_fontset() 系関数の使い分けを
考えなくてもそれなりの多言語表示ができるようになったのは(゚д゚)ウマーと思われ。

>>100
Gtk+ 1.2 と Gtk+ 2.x のライブラリとは普通に共存できますがなにか
NGNG
今後開発されるであろうGTKを使ったツールが、
GTK1ではなくGTK2で開発されるようになったらって事じゃないの?
まあ、GTK1が完全に廃れるまではそうならないだろうけど。
103山崎渉
垢版 |
NGNG
(^^)
NGNG
関連リンク
http://pc.2ch.net/test/read.cgi/unix/998762559/244
105山崎渉
垢版 |
NGNG
(^^)
106あぼーん
垢版 |
NGNG
あぼーん
NGNG
IceWMのthemeがMotifです。
落ち着くんだよ…
108あぼーん
垢版 |
NGNG
あぼーん
109あぼーん
垢版 |
NGNG
あぼーん
NGNG
◎人の嫌がることをズケッと言うのはこんな奴!
<アスペルガー症候群(自閉症スペクトラム)←脳の機能的疾患(遺伝が要因)>
●変化を嫌う
http://web.kyoto-inet.or.jp/org/atoz3/kado/book1/Williams-Asp.htm

●接し方のルールがわからず無邪気に周囲の人に対して迷惑なことをしてしまうことがある。人を傷つけるということには鈍感(相手の立場に立って考えられない)。
●パターン的行動、生真面目すぎて融通が利かない
 毎朝の通学電車では同じホームの同じ場所から、同じ時間の同じ号車に乗ることに決めていたりする。パターンを好むということは反復を厭わないことでもある。
●アスペルガー症候群の子どもは(大人も)感覚刺激に対して敏感。敏感さは聴覚、視覚、味覚、嗅覚、温痛覚などのいずれの感覚の敏感さもありえる(特に視覚が敏感)。
●アスペルガー症候群の子ども(大人も)は予測できないことや変化に対して苦痛を感じることが多い。
http://www.autism.jp/l-02-03-aspe3.htm

●独り言を言うことが多い(考えていることを口に出す)
●物事をいつまでも同じにしておこうとする欲求が強く、そうでないと非常に不安。いわゆる「こだわり」。
●自発的に行動することが少なく、興味の幅が狭い
●物まねをしているような不自然な言語表現
●自閉症スペクトラム全体としては一万人に91人(およそ100人に1人)。
http://www.ypdc.net/asuperugar.htm

★自閉症スペクトラムの考え方(アスペルガーに至らない気質の偏りもある(遺伝性))
http://www.imaizumi-web.com/030413.html  
   
★アスペルガー症候群(自閉症スペクトラム)かどうかのテスト
http://twitwi.s10.xrea.com/psy/add.htm 
http://www.geocities.co.jp/Beautycare/5917/as/marksheetmake.html
111名無しさん@お腹いっぱい。
垢版 |
NGNG
>>11
ハゲシクワラタw
まさか、それをもってくるとは
NGNG
motif って何て読むの?
モティフって発音してたけど、英語的にはモウティーフって感じかな。
NGNG
楽器屋の人はモチーフって読んでたな
スペルが同じだからOKか?
114あぼーん
垢版 |
NGNG
あぼーん
115名無しさん@お腹いっぱい。
垢版 |
NGNG
http://www.lesstif.org/apps.html
http://ayapin.film.s.dendai.ac.jp/~matuda/Clocks/catclock.zip
motifを使った面白いソフトって無いですか?
NGNG
>>115
Motifを使った面白い「人」なら居るんだが・・・・
粉(ry
117あぼーん
垢版 |
NGNG
あぼーん
118115
垢版 |
NGNG
>>116
レスありがとうございます。 
無いんですね・・・

NGNG
Motifを使った面白い人というと、Cygwinの偉い人を思い出してしまうま。
NGNG
http://www.ichihime.jp/labo/page/products/motif/motif_p.html
これだ!!
NGNG
掃除してたら mootif って CD が出てきた。ハァ-ナツカシ
122あぼーん
垢版 |
NGNG
あぼーん
NGNG
motif使うぐらいならathena使った方が互換性は高い。
NGNG
athena使うくらいならmotif使った方が見ためがまだまし。
NGNG
Xaw 互換のライブラリ使えば無問題。

ttp://www.startide.jp/~dtana/motif/
NGNG
OpenMotif って日本語使えるの?
127名無しさん@お腹いっぱい。
垢版 |
NGNG
すんまそん。

何方か、Mgvのサイトが何処へいったかご存じないでしょうか?
NGNG
>>126
亀レスだが使えるよ。リソースの設定をしっかりな。
129保守
垢版 |
NGNG
age
NGNG
Xaw完全互換ではないけど、
殆ど互換のウィジェットを沢山作れば良いんでそ。
Xaw80%,Motif20%とか。そんな感じで。
131名無しさん@お腹いっぱい。
垢版 |
NGNG
モチーフ or モティーフでいいんでしょうか
自分読みはモーティフなんですが?
NGNG
[moutí:f] と読むのが正しい。
俺は「もちーふ」って読むけどな。
NGNG
モティフ
NGNG
モ〜(牛)ティフとか無かった?
NGNG
Moo-Tiffだね。Motif1.2互換。

その後Motif2.0がフリーで出てきたから意味なくなった。
スライダーバーの挙動が相変わらずおかしいけど、
もうバグフィックスなんかされないんだろうな。
136名無しさん@お腹いっぱい。
垢版 |
NGNG
今時Motif の仕事だって。
某商用UNIX で動いてたのを OpenMotif on Linux に移植&大幅に機能追加。

本屋行って参考書探して、とりあえず林秀幸氏のやつは買った。
たけど、網羅的なリファレンスマニュアル本がないんだよねー。
(なんかソフトバンクの陰謀で日本語版がでないとか聞いたけど、マジ?)

しょうがないんで倉庫の奥底から資料引っ張りだして来たけど、
Motif のバージョンが1.1 とか書いてあるのばっか。

OpenMotif は当然のように2.2 使うわけだけど、バージョンが違っても
問題ないかな?
日本語関連とかは変わってたりするかも、って心配なんだけど?

NGNG
>>136
いや、駄目だ
1.1と今のはまったくの別物
PDFで提供されてる英語のリファレンス読んでやれ
NGNG
そうなのか...orz
頑張って英語よむしかないか。サンクス
レスを投稿する

5ちゃんねるの広告が気に入らない場合は、こちらをクリックしてください。

ニューススポーツなんでも実況